Sam – 9 week old male German Shepherd cross Labrador
Sam is a 9 week old German Shepherd cross Labrador puppy who came in as an unwanted pet. He has been first vaccinated, microchipped, wormed and deflead. Sam’s new owner will be expected to get Sam castrated at 5 months old as stated in the rescue contract. Sam can live happily with other dogs (and would quite like to as he is currently living a group of 7 and is very sociable) and is fine with cats and smaller caged animals. Sam cannot be homed with young children.
